Cloud Engineer
Role to design, implement and maintain scalable, secure Microsoft Azure environments using Infrastructure as Code, networking, security and automation while collaborating with technical teams and business stakeholders.
Key responsibilities
- Architect, deploy and maintain scalable Azure infrastructure ensuring high availability, optimized performance and cost efficiency.
- Develop and manage reusable Infrastructure as Code modules using Bicep and TerraForm with integrated automation and CI/CD workflows.
- Configure and secure Azure networking components and enforce cloud security best practices including identity management, zero trust principles and policy compliance.
- Monitor system performance, troubleshoot complex infrastructure and application issues, and drive continuous operational improvements.
- Communicate proactively with stakeholders by translating technical concepts into business context and fostering transparent collaboration.
- Collaborate with teams to adopt operational policies, share knowledge and support reliable, secure cloud solutions.
